UN Watch’s final tally of the UN General Assembly’s 2018 bias against Israel was shared by opinion leaders worldwide and went viral.
Total of 2018 Condemnations adopted at UN General Assembly:
🇮🇱 Israel 21
🇮🇷 Iran 1
🇸🇾 Syria 1
🇰🇵 North Korea 1
🇷🇺 Russia 1
🇲🇲 Myanmar 1
🇺🇸 US 1
🇩🇿 Algeria 0
🇨🇳 China 0
🏴☠️ Hamas 0
🇮🇶 Iraq 0
🇵🇰 Pakistan 0
🇶🇦 Qatar 0
🇸🇦 Saudi 0
🇸🇴 Somalia 0
🇹🇷 Turkey 0
🇻🇪 Venezuela 0
🇿🇼 Zimbabwe 0— Hillel Neuer (@HillelNeuer) December 26, 2018
